使用日志文件恢复数据库
🔍【数据库崩溃不用怕!教你如何使用日志文件恢复数据,轻松拯救你的重要信息🔍】
们!今天我要和大家分享一个非常重要的技能——如何使用日志文件恢复数据库!相信很多在工作中都遇到过数据库崩溃的情况,丢失了宝贵的数据,是不是感到非常头疼呢?别担心,今天就来教大家如何利用日志文件恢复数据库,让你的重要信息失而复得!
一、什么是日志文件?
日志文件(Log File)是数据库在运行过程中记录的一系列操作记录,包括数据变更、错误信息等。日志文件对于数据库的恢复和数据备份具有重要意义。
二、使用日志文件恢复数据库的步骤
1. 确定恢复目标
在开始恢复数据库之前,首先要明确自己的恢复目标,例如恢复某个表的数据、恢复整个数据库等。
2. 查找日志文件
根据数据库类型,找到对应的日志文件。例如,MySQL数据库的日志文件通常位于数据目录下的`mysql-bin`目录中。
3. 分析日志文件
使用数据库管理工具或编程语言读取日志文件,分析其中的操作记录。了解数据变更的顺序和内容,为后续恢复做准备。
4. 恢复数据库
根据分析结果,使用以下方法恢复数据库:
(1)备份原始数据库:在恢复之前,先将原始数据库备份,以防恢复过程中出现问题。
(2)使用数据库管理工具恢复:对于某些数据库管理系统(如MySQL、Oracle等),可以通过图形界面进行恢复操作。
(3)编写脚本恢复:对于复杂的恢复操作,可以编写脚本实现自动化恢复。
5. 验证恢复结果
恢复完成后,对数据库进行验证,确保数据已成功恢复。
三、注意事项
1. 确保日志文件完整:在恢复过程中,务必确保日志文件完整,否则恢复效果可能不理想。
2. 选择合适的恢复方法:根据实际情况选择合适的恢复方法,如备份恢复、日志恢复等。
3. 避免重复操作:在恢复过程中,避免重复操作,以免导致数据丢失。
4. 定期备份:为了避免数据丢失,建议定期备份数据库,以防万一。
四、
通过本文,相信大家对使用日志文件恢复数据库有了更深入的了解。在遇到数据库崩溃的情况时,不妨尝试使用日志文件恢复数据,让你的重要信息失而复得。当然,为了避免数据丢失,建议定期备份数据库,确保数据安全。

希望这篇文章能帮助到大家,如果觉得有用,记得点赞、转发哦!💪💪💪
(注:本文仅供参考,具体操作请根据实际情况进行调整。)